STEM教育理念下的初中数学“扇形统计图”的探究式教学设计——以“绘制浙江地形统计图”项目为例
Inquiry Teaching Design of “Fan Chart” in Junior Middle School Mathematics under STEM Education Concept—Taking the Project of “Drawing the Topography Statistical Map of Zhejiang” as an Example
摘要: STEM是科学、技术、工程、数学四门学科英文首字母的缩写,具有跨学科与探究性学习的特征。本文基于STEM教育理念,在初中数学教学中融合了地理科学,信息技术,桥梁工程。以Excel软件为工具,通过创设调查浙江地形统计图的问题情景,对初中数学“扇形统计图”进行了项目化探究式的教学设计——绘制出浙江地形统计图,以提升学生的学习兴趣,并获得相应的数学活动经验。
Abstract:
STEM is the abbreviation of the English initials of science, technology, engineering and mathemat-ics, which is characterized by interdisciplinary and inquiry-based learning. Based on STEM educa-tion concept, this paper integrates geographic science, information technology and bridge engineering in junior middle school mathematics teaching. Using Excel software as a tool, by creating a problem scenario to investigate the topography of Zhejiang, this paper carried out a project-based inquiry teaching design on the “fan statistical map” of junior middle school mathematics, drawing the topography of Zhejiang, in order to enhance students’ learning interest and obtain the corre-sponding mathematical activity experience.
